On July 15, 1997, the world was stunned when fashion icon Gianni Versace was gunned down on the steps of his South Beach mansion. But this wasn’t where the story started. In our debut episode, we rewind the timeline and uncover the chilling path that led to that moment, through five lives, four states, and one of the most tragic investigative failures in modern history.From the overlooked victims, Jeff Trail, David Madson, Lee Miglin, and William Reese, to the glamor, grief, and media chaos that followed Versace’s murder, we’re telling the story behind the headlines. This is not just about fashion.
